What's the distinction between thermit welding and flash butt welding for railway rails? Flash butt welding (FBW) takes advantage of electrical resistance heating with mechanical tension to forge-weld rail finishes collectively, producing a wrought microstructure with excellent mechanical Houses. FBW needs weighty stationary or cell equipment and an electrical offer. Thermit welding uses the aluminothermic chemical response to generate liquid weld steel, demands no electricity supply, is totally portable, and might be performed any where around the track.

The HAZ in the thermit weld is characterised by a coarse-grained region adjacent into the fusion boundary, where the big thermal input from the molten thermit metallic has induced austenite grain growth, and also a refined grain zone more through the fusion boundary in which the temperature was sufficient for normalisation without grain coarsening.
